What are the penalties for violating trade laws in Australia?

Ask a Compensation Law lawyer in Bacchus Marsh

Penalties for violating trade laws can include fines, imprisonment, and the revocation of export or import licenses.;Non-compliance can also result in seizure of goods and reputational damage for the business involved.
